    Abstract

    In order to provide the visible span of satellite for photoelectrical theodolite, we discuss the forecast method for the visible span of artificial satellites. Three important factors including height, shadow and sunlight are analyzed. The method has been used on a certain kind of photoelectrical theodolite.Choosing INTERCOSMOS and other three satellites as samples, experimental results indicate that this method can provide accurate visible span of satellite and fulfill the requirement precision of 103.629 ms. The method reduces the waiting time and advances the efficiency of operating staffs.
